I am definintely considering Eisenmann Race Exhaust but I am not sure if I want to do catless or catted, and x-pipe or h-flow. What's better for a NA engine?
Slow63
02-01-2013, 09:48 AM
I am definintely considering Eisenmann Race Exhaust but I am not sure if I want to do catless or catted, and x-pipe or h-flow. What's better for a NA engine?
For performance I'm sure X pipe will be better because the flow crosses each other smoothly and also creates a higher pitch exhaust sound. H-pipe might be a little bit louder because more flow is going straight than some flow making a 90 degree turn to connect. Also H pipe will sound deeper.
I would personally go X pipe if I were you lol, I think that higher pitch note is more suitable for BMW. The sound level difference is very little, and X pipe will help accelerate smoother and a bit of performance gain.
